The combat really is the best thing about the game. It's not slow at all and (for your first playthrough anyway) you need to combine realtime fast paced action with the turn based stuff. So what you end up doing is positioning, using a few real-time skills to weaken/prepare your enemies, then quickly going into turn based mode to queue up a series of attacks.

The thing is that it's VERY quick. You don't need to spend a significant amount of time planning or choosing things from a menu or waiting for enemies to take their turns. You choose your turn based actions in real time so that it FEELS very fluid.
